<blockquote data-quote="Crimson" data-source="post: 406694" data-attributes="member: 5079"><p>I'm excited that the next two AVENGERS films will be directed by the Russo Brothers who are responsible for the best MCU films, so I'm willing to give this creative choice the benefit of the doubt ... but it reeks of desperate stunt casting. RDJ is a great actor who found the role of a lifetime in Tony Stark, but he is a perplexingly bad choice for Dr. Doom even if he wasn't already associated with Iron Man. Nothing about RDJ has indicated that 'menacing' is in his repertoire as an actor and he is, quite frankly, rather old to be playing the character. Paying an ungodly millions of dollars to an actor who's the face of the MCU to play a character who should be permanently masked leads me to fear this Doom will be frequently mask-less.</p></blockquote><p></p>
